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: Patients with chronic pain Gender: male and female Age: between 18 and 80 years of age, inclusive Pathology: chronic pain history of 3 months or longer pain has been considered by a physician to be either of neuropathic origin, or resulting from nerve damage due to diabetes mellitus, of postherpetic neuralgia, of phantom pain (i.e., pain resulting from an amputed limb) Weight: no specific criteria;Healthy volunteers Gender: male and female Age: between 18 and 80 years of age, inclusive Weight: no specific criteria
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: Patients with chronic pain: - mental handicap;Healthy volunteers: - history of chronic pain - history of neurological disorders - history of psychiatric disorders - regular use of pain medication

| Criteria for evaluation Assessments: Detection thresholds and pain thresholds for thermal and mechanical stimulation, number of paradoxical heat sensations during the thermal sensory limen procedure, mechanical pain sensitivity, dynamic mechanical allodynia, temporal pain summation, vibration detection threshold, pressure pain threshold. Statistical methods: Z-scores will be calculated for each QST parameter. | — |
